The Facts Are Not Disputed

Compelling witness after compelling witness told the truth – and that truth devastated #BenedictDonald in the impeachment hearings. Despite all the alternative reality craziness spun by Republicons, the facts are incontrovertible. We are now down to a choice: Corruption or patriotism? Country or Party? America or Russia? It’s #DecisionTime for 53 Republican Senators.